Scotsdike lies in the Anglo-Scottish borderlands, about 6km from Longtown. Reach it via the A7 from Carlisle or the B6357 from Langholm, with good connections to the M74. The area has roughly 25 EV charging points nearby. The village takes its name from a 16th-century earthwork that marked the disputed border between England and Scotland.
